Senators Max Baucus (D-Mt) and Charles Grassley (R-Ia) will hold hearings into the Bear Stearns deal with JP Morgan Chase.

::::::::

Senators Max Baucus (D-Mt), Chair, and Senator Charles Grassley (R-Ia), Ranking Member, US Senate Finance Committee, are to be commended for requesting a hearing into the recent transaction involving the acquisition of Bear Stearns by JP Morgan Chase.

The senators are requesting that the corporate executives involved in negotiating the terms of the transaction, the Chairman of the US Federal Reserve Bank, Mr. Bernanke, Secretary of the Treasury Henry Paulson, and NY Fed Bank Governor, Timothy Geithner, appear before the committee for oversight hearings.
